GEORGETOWN, Guyana (AP) — Caribbean leaders mentioned Tuesday that every one teams and political events besides one have submitted nominees for a transitional presidential council charged with deciding on an interim prime minister for Haiti, which stays engulfed in gang violence.
The original nine-member council was whittled right down to eight members after the Pitit Desalin occasion led by former senator and presidential candidate Jean-Charles Moïse declined a seat final week. Moïse is allied with Man Philippe, a former police official and insurgent chief who served time within the U.S. after pleading responsible to cash laundering.
The Dec. 21 group, which is allied with Prime Minister Ariel Henry, was one of many final holdouts, submitting a reputation Monday to the regional commerce group generally known as Caricom. Its nomination had been delayed by infighting as group leaders bickered over potential candidates.
Henry, who stays locked out of Haiti as a result of ongoing gang violence has compelled the closure of its principal worldwide airport, has promised to resign as soon as the transitional council is created. He was on an official journey to Kenya pushing for the U.N.-backed deployment of a police power from the East African nation to battle gangs in Haiti when armed gunmen launched assaults on Feb. 29 within the capital, Port-au-Prince, which might be nonetheless ongoing. The deployment has been delayed.
Gangs have torched police stations, opened hearth on the principle worldwide airport and stormed Haiti’s two largest prisons, releasing more than 4,000 inmates. On Monday, they attacked and looted houses in two upscale communities that had beforehand remained peaceable, killing at least a dozen people during the rampage.
Scores of individuals have been killed throughout the assaults, and round 17,000 individuals have been left homeless, the bulk fleeing to Haiti’s calmer southern area, in accordance with the U.N. Workplace for the Coordination of Humanitarian Affairs.
“We’re very involved in regards to the violence,” mentioned Guyanese President Irfaan Ali, who can be the Caricom chairman.
He advised reporters on Monday night time that point was of essence given the state of affairs, including that officers stay looking forward to progress.
“We now have been having steady conferences virtually each night time, as a result of the Haitians need to get the presidential council in place,” he mentioned. “Progress has been made.”
Along with deciding on an interim prime minister, the council shall be liable for appointing a council of ministers, a provisional electoral council and a nationwide safety council. All members of the transitional council additionally should again the deployment of a international armed power.
These awarded a spot on the council are EDE/RED, a celebration led by former Prime Minister Claude Joseph; the Montana Accord, a gaggle of civil society leaders, political events and others; Fanmi Lavalas, the occasion of former President Jean-Bertrand Aristide; the Jan. 30 Collective, which represents events together with that of former President Michel Martelly; and the personal sector.
Of the remaining two nonvoting positions, one would go to a consultant of Haiti’s civil society and the opposite to its spiritual sector.
Caricom officers haven’t launched the total listing of names nominated to the council.
